The **Wolf Eye tattoo idea** encapsulates the powerful, piercing gaze of a wolf, often illustrated with intricate details that convey both intensity and mystique, This design typically features a close-up of the wolf's eye, richly rendered to capture the animal's striking coloration—often in shades of vibrant yellows, icy blues, or deep greens—set against a contrasting, shadowy background, Such tattoos can be framed by elements that symbolize the wolf's natural habitat, like trees or moonlit skies, enhancing the overall aesthetic, As one of the most compelling tattoo ideas, the Wolf Eye has gained popularity among animal lovers and nature enthusiasts alike, embodying both a visual allure and an emotional connection to wilderness themes, The historical background of Wolf Eye tattoos can be traced to indigenous cultures that revered the wolf as a spirit animal or totem, In many Native American traditions, the wolf symbolizes loyalty, courage, and teamwork, while the eye represents perception and insight into the mysteries of life, This cultural narrative contributes to the richness of the tattoo idea, as it reflects the wolf's profound significance in myth and folklore, often associated with guidance and protection, This deep-seated respect for the creature imbues the **Wolf Eye tattoo** with layers of meaning, making it not just a beautiful piece of art but a portal into personal and ancestral histories, Symbolically, the Wolf Eye tattoo captures the essence of intuition, awareness, and the instinctual connection to nature, It reflects the ability to see beyond the surface, embracing truths that are often hidden from ordinary perception, Whether worn as a tribute to a love for wildlife or as a personal emblem of inner strength and vigilance, the tattoo resonates on cultural, spiritual, and personal levels, The fierce determination of the wolf serves as a reminder to stay sharp, like the watchful eye of the predator, always aware of one’s surroundings and actions, Among the diverse tattoo styles available, the Wolf Eye tattoo idea lends itself particularly well to realism and neo-traditional styles.
These approaches allow for a greater level of detail and depth, giving the wolf's eye a lifelike quality that can invoke a sense of presence, Black and grey styles can add a dramatic tone to the piece, while watercolor techniques can inject a vibrant fluidity that emphasizes the wildness of the design, Each chosen style can dramatically alter the tattoo's overall effect, leading to an extraordinarily personal expression of this mesmerizing concept, Ideal placements for the **Wolf Eye tattoo** include areas such as the forearm, upper arm, or the back of the shoulder, where the expansive canvas allows for intricate detailing, The forearm placement not only showcases the tattoo prominently but also aligns with the idea of being vigilant and aware, much like the gaze of the wolf itself, Alternatively, a design on the back presents an opportunity for a large, sprawling piece that can incorporate surrounding elements to create a narrative that draws viewers in, Creative adaptations of the Wolf Eye tattoo might include incorporating geometric shapes to reflect a modern twist or merging the eye with other symbols, such as feathers, arrows, or natural landscapes, to enhance its storytelling aspect, Some tattoo artists may even opt for a surrealistic interpretation, merging the wolf's eye with elements of fantasy to evoke a dream-like state, This could lead to endless possibilities for personal interpretations, making the design truly unique to each wearer, In conclusion, **Wolf Eye tattoo ideas** offer not only a striking visual but also a meaningful representation of awareness and connection to nature, As one explores different *tattoo ideas*, this powerful design stands out for its potent symbolism, rich historical background, and adaptability across various artistic styles, making it a favored choice among tattoo enthusiasts.
